04 / Engineering principles

Three bets. Zero hype.

We don't have a methodology, we have constraints. Every system we ship has to satisfy these three before it leaves our hands.

01

Observable by Default

Every AI operation is instrumented from day one: cost, tokens, latency, success rate, decision trail. If you can't see it, you can't trust it.

02

Agentic Architecture

Networks of specialized agents, each independently testable and replaceable. Monolithic AI is fragile. Coordinated agents survive contact with reality.

03

Distillation

Repeated AI calls compress into deterministic functions. The system gets smarter and cheaper with every run, instead of more expensive.

05 / The cost decay curve

AI that gets cheaper the more you use it.

Traditional AI scales linearly with usage. More calls, more cost, forever. Distillation inverts the curve: the system observes patterns in its own behavior and converts them into deterministic functions that run at near-zero cost.
